欢迎来到天天文库
浏览记录
ID:30381126
大小:100.61 KB
页数:17页
时间:2018-12-29
《《转aspstudy》word版》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、转aspstudynotes2010-6-26ASP程序设计11、读懂源代码2、修改源代码3、做一些应用系统、电子商务网站总的包括四个方面内容1-3章+附录casp基础部分第2章运行环境附录3HTML第三部分脚本语言VBSCRIPTJAVASCRIPT4-6章asp中的五个内部对象第四章实现客户端和服务器端的交互会话对象每个用户有特定的信息,如用户名、密码、IP等这些都可以保存在服务器端,在登录的时候已经储存在服务器里面,当访问其它页面的时候不需要再输入了,注意单个用户的信息不能永远保存在服务器。网页过期的原因就是单个用户的信息过期了,会话对象就是保存这些信息
2、的。应用对象是用来保存所有用户的存储信息上的。SERVER对象是用来生成一个组件的对象实例而出现的一个内部对象7-10章为什么要学习数据库?所有的数据都存储在数据库中ASP的六个内部组件8章ASP的ADO组件,核心内容10章其它组件广告、计数器组件起到美化作用兼容组件为了实现不同浏览器版本的信息的收集文件超链接组件可以让我们在线的维护11章第三方组件比如开发或下载一个ASP本身不能实现的功能,放到ASP中,来实现我们需要的功能。做成动态链接库,放到里面。ASP程序设计2第一章网络程序概述产生背景ASPPHPJSPINERNET技术简介计算机网络最早基于UNIX
3、平台www技术的出现,INTERNET开始大规模出现,www技术是因特网的代名词应用系统的开发不能离开www技术www应用传统网络编程工具--CGI(统一网关接口)这个技术比较复杂动态网页一定是交互式的(客户端和服务器之间的交互)目前主要网络程序设计语言服务器实际上是一个软件的概念,即使配置再低也是一个服务器,只要装了服务器软件最早的软件开发的结构式一个文件服务器的结构。什么是文件服务器结构呢?就是让所有的数据都存储到文件服务器里,当使用到这些数据的时候,就把这些数据下载到工作站,这是个服务器到工作站的工程,所有的信息处理的工作是在工作站上实现的。随着服务器性
4、能的提高,查询的工作由工作站转到服务器中,这样就节约了带宽,但是对服务器的性能要求比较高。从文件服务器模式过渡到客户机服务器模式。然后又过渡到浏览服务器模式。前台是浏览器,中间是WEB服务器,后面是数据库服务器ASP就是在浏览器与WEB服务器之间,WEB服务器与数据库服务器之间进行交互。静态网页就是没有交互的网页动态网页就是客户机与服务器之间存在交互ASP是微软公司的产品PHP个人用户,是电脑爱好者发明的语言,和linux类似JSP是SUN公司的产品,是唯一敢跟微软公司叫板的公司。是JAVA语言的一部分。ASP优点简单易学不需要编译和连接,直接解释运行ADO存
5、取DB面向对象编程,扩展组件功能不存在浏览器兼容问题因为运行在服务器端的可以隐藏程序代码ASP缺点运行速度较慢由于脚本语言运行的时候没有经过编译,所以运行的时候较慢些。唯一支持ASP的网络操作系统只有是windows平台所以很多国外的网站选择JSP就是基于这个原因考虑NOS不支持PHP优点免费开发源代码多平台支持不受浏览器的限制效率高PHP缺点没有大公司支持运行环境相对复杂学习稍难,类似CGIjsp优点多平台编译后运行运行效率高,占用资源少JAVA技术实现跨平台,是网络上的世界语JSP缺点运行环境相对复杂学习稍难第二章ASP初步ASP的运行环境安装PWS4.0
6、WINDOWS98上装的web服务器的软件就叫做PWS装到win2000server版,内置IIS127.0.0.1测试TCP/IP是否正常运行虚拟目录根据文件夹的别名找到真正文件夹的位置,目的使得我们在输地址的时候简单一点默认文档就是在输地址的时候,出现的第一个页面默认主页一个简单的ASP程序htmlheadtitle一个简单的ASP程序/title/headbodyH2align="center"欢迎您光临我的主页/H2palign="center"%n=Year(date())y=Month(date())r=Day(date())sj="您来访的时间是
7、:"&n&"年"&y&"月"&r&"日"Response.Writesj%/bodyhtmlASP文件组成和约定用客户端的脚本可以实现用户名和密码的保持约定默认的脚本语言VBSCRIPT编写ASP文件注意事项和c语言不一样,ASP不区分大小写,标点符号一定要在英文状态下输入,ASP程序要分行写,注释行用一个逗号',%%位置问题,良好的书写习惯回车键、空格键注意使用设置PWS4.0ASP语法简介asp程序设计4介绍HTML第二章Web页面制作基础2.1HTML语言概述HTML超文本标记语言,不是编程语言,而是一种描述性标记语言,是吧一些信息根据需要连接起来的信息
8、管理技术基本链接所以链接执行连接锚点分
此文档下载收益归作者所有